21xrx.com
2025-03-22 12:35:48 Saturday
文章检索 我的文章 写文章
Java开发工程师同时担任前端和后端角色
2023-06-14 11:41:54 深夜i     7     0
Java开发工程师 前端开发 后端开发

作为一名Java开发工程师,不仅仅需要掌握后端编程技术,还需要具备一定的前端开发能力。随着前后端分离技术的发展,前端开发在Java开发中的地位越来越重要。

在很多公司中,Java开发工程师需要掌握Vue.js、React等前端框架,能够编写前端组件和页面。同时,作为后端开发者,还需要使用Spring Boot等技术栈来构建RESTful API,提供数据支持。下面是一个简单的代码案例:

@RestController
public class UserController {
  @Autowired
  private UserService userService;
  @GetMapping("/users")
  public List
  getUsers() {
 
    return userService.getUserList();
  }
  @PostMapping("/user")
  public User createUser(@RequestBody User user) {
    return userService.save(user);
  }
  @PutMapping("/user/{id}")
  public User updateUser(@PathVariable("id") Long id, @RequestBody User user) {
    user.setId(id);
    return userService.save(user);
  }
  @DeleteMapping("/user/{id}")
  public void deleteUser(@PathVariable("id") Long id) {
    userService.delete(id);
  }
}

上面的代码实现了一个简单的用户管理接口,包括获取用户列表、创建用户、更新用户和删除用户。在前端方面,可以使用Vue.js来呈现数据和交互,代码示例如下:

vue

 
 

   
    
     
      
      
      
      
     
    
    
     
      
      
      
      
     
    
   
 
  
   
    ID
    Name
    Email
    Action
   
  
  
   
    {{ user.id }}
    {{ user.name }}
    {{ user.email }}
    
             Edit
             Delete
   
  
 
   
 
     
  Edit User
     
  Create User
     
  
       Name:
       
       Email:
       
       Save
       Cancel
      
  
    
 
   Create User

从上面的代码可以看出,Java开发工程师需要掌握后端技术和前端技术,才能更好地完成项目开发。因此,Java开发工程师即使在担任后端开发角色的时候,也需要积极学习和尝试前端开发技术。

  
  

评论区